- Data and Digital Outputs Management Plan Template
A full Data and Digital Outputs Management Plan for an awarded Belmont Forum project is a living, actively updated document that describes the data management life cycle for the data and other digital outputs to be collected, reused, processed, and or generated As part of making research data open by default, findable, accessible, interoperable, and reusable (FAIR), the Plan should elaborate
